About this Position:

The Delivery Buyer manages mass production part ordering and delivery through effective planning, communication, and supplier interface. You will apply technical and problem-solving skills to prevent impact to operations and support achievement of department targets; be responsible for material procurement, production planning, inventory control, outsourcing, supplier process management and countermeasure implementation; and identify, research, evaluate, and select suppliers that meet the defined standards of price, quality, and reliability of supply (design change points).

Responsibilities include:

  • Thorough understanding and accurate maintenance of process related systems for suppliers and parts assigned to buyer. Material releases, service parts, maintenance within GPCS to ensure sufficient inventory levels to support warehouse packing operations and plant production.
  • Establish and maintain communication networks with supply base to promote positive relationship focused on delivery performance (building relationships with suppliers)
  • Identify, evaluate, and escalate critical issues to management to ensure appropriate allocation of resources in a timely manner. Buyer identifies gaps and develops specific countermeasures to mitigate risk of critical issue.
  • Continually develop communication networks, both external and internal, to ensure operational success and department awareness. Work with PC, Suppliers, SOM, PED, SCM Ops, SPEC Control, etc. when implementing input changes that will generate changepoints to buyer-controlled suppliers.
  • Collaborate with departments project leaders to support all specified Mass Production (Site Delivery Powertrain) department projects to meet Key Performance Indicators (KPI) targets by mitigating risk of Downtime, GDP, and TRPU through quick reaction and countermeasure development.
  • Understand and manage New Model and Mass Production design change activity through close collaboration w/ impacted supplier to ensure quality and effective date implementation to minimize Production impact and cost to Honda.
  • Maintain reporting and Gemba activity for root cause analysis / countermeasure implementation to solve complex problems. Process management and countermeasure implementation through Gemba activity internally (plant/warehouse) and externally (supplier production facilities/warehouses).
  • Strive for continuous improvement through cycling Plan Do Check Action (PDCA) for area of responsibility (supplier ordering, design change control management, Supplier Problem Management, etc) to ensure associate success
  • Develop capability of self, colleagues, and team through training, mentoring, and sharing of experiences in the area of technical expertise and understanding for succession planning and team growth
  • Support company vision and Business Plan activity by leading/supporting in Marutoku theme activity and/or project initiatives w/in associates core job function
